The Arizona Coyotes have finally been able to showcase the star defenseman after he missed the first 16 games of the season. Chychrun has been one of the hottest trade bait pieces since last year's Trade Deadline, and he's raising his stock back up again.
In those eight games, Chychrun has been elite and both ends of the ice, recording three goals and four assists and shutting down the opponent's best players.
In November, it was reported that Arizona GM Bill Armstrong's ask for the defenseman remains high, with the Coyotes wanting multiple first-round picks and an NHL prospect or youngster in exchange.
The Florida native is currently in the fourth year of a six-year, $27.6 million contract, which comes with an AAV of $4.6 million. Chychrun has mostly been linked to the Edmonton Oilers, Los Angeles Kings, Florida Panthers, Toronto Maple Leafs and Ottawa Senators.
